Ngoma Women’s Prison

I had a joyous time visiting the 600 prisoners here, bringing them news that we are able to begin their sewing school with 25 new machines, all the materials, and a paid professional trainer for 6 months. An anonymous donation has made this possible. The ladies remembered that I taught them in March that God loves them, that he has not forgotten them, and that he has a hope and a future for them.
